1. Visible Cracks, Warping, or Holes in Your Siding

Cracks and warping are clear indicators that your siding in Coatesville has reached the end of its lifespan. Once moisture penetrates these openings, it can lead to mold, rot, and interior wall damage.

2. Faded or Discolored Exterior Walls

Constant exposure to sunlight and harsh weather causes fading over time. If your siding color has dulled or become uneven, the protective coating may be wearing off.

3. Frequent Need for Repainting

If you find yourself repainting every 4–5 years, your siding is no longer holding paint properly. This is often a sign of moisture damage or material fatigue.

5. Interior Wall Damage or Peeling Paint

If interior paint or wallpaper is peeling, it could be due to trapped moisture entering through failing siding. This often occurs when sealants, flashing, or caulking break down.

6. Mold, Mildew, or Rot

Moisture is every Pennsylvania homeowner’s worst enemy. When water seeps behind siding, it can lead to mold growth and wood rot compromising your home’s structure and indoor air quality.

8. Pest or Insect Damage

Termites, carpenter ants, and woodpeckers can wreak havoc on older wooden siding. If you notice holes, soft spots, or sawdust-like residue, pests may have moved in behind your walls.

New siding replacement options like vinyl and fiber cement are pest-resistant and protect your home from future infestations.

1. How long does new siding last?

With proper installation, modern vinyl siding lasts 30–40 years, while fiber cement can last up to 50 years or more. Routine maintenance extends lifespan even further.

4. Is it better to repair or replace damaged siding?

If damage is widespread, full siding replacement is more cost-effective long-term. Localized repairs may temporarily fix small sections, but won’t solve hidden moisture issues.
